When designing a new pool or remodeling an existing one, choosing the right pool deck is critical. It should be comfortable underfoot, provide adequate traction to prevent slips and falls, and complement the surrounding landscape. Concrete is an excellent option for a pool deck since it resists fading, staining and cracking. Staining the concrete is a great way to add color, and decorative surface treatments like exposed aggregate or imprinted borders can be added. Concrete Concrete is a strong, long-lasting material that’s ideal for pool decking . It can stand up to a variety of weather conditions, including heat and moisture. Concrete can also be molded into different shapes to create a unique look for your pool deck. Unlike some materials, concrete can reflect the sun’s heat rather than absorb it, making it easier on your feet. It is also highly slip resistant, which can help prevent accidents around the pool. Design The design phase of a deck building project starts with a thorough analysis of the space, its connections to the house, and how people will use it. Ideally, the deck should fit into the esthetic style and structure of the house while reflecting the personality and needs of its owners. A deck must have access to the house and, if needed, to lawn or garden areas. Stairways and paths are the best ways to provide access, but ramps can be useful as well. A pergola is a great way to add character and charm to your outdoor living space. It also offers protection from Perth’s harsh sun and rain, as well as a frame for climbing plants. Pergolas can be constructed from various materials, including timber and aluminium. One option that is growing in popularity is glulam wood, which consists of smaller sections of timber glued together. Adding Value to Your Home A pergola can add value to your home by defining the space and providing an outdoor structure that’s visually appealing. These structures also allow for natural air flow while providing shade and enhancing your backyard. Adding an attractive and well-designed pergola can help you make the most of your backyard space, and it can be a great selling point when it comes time to sell your home.
